Subject: [PATCH] [SCEV] Fix isImpliedViaMerge() with values from previous
iteration (PR56242)
When trying to prove an implied condition on a phi by proving it
for all incoming values, we need to be careful about values coming
from a backedge, as these may refer to a previous loop iteration.
A variant of this issue was fixed in D101829, but the dominance
condition used there isn't quite right: It checks that the value
dominates the incoming block, which doesn't exclude backedges
(values defined in a loop will usually dominate the loop latch,
which is the incoming block of the backedge).
Instead, we should be checking for domination of the phi block.
Any values defined inside the loop will not dominate the loop
header phi.
Fixes https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/issues/56242.
